BROOKLYN - Premier Boxing Champions (PBC) on Spike returned to Brooklyn's Barclays Center on Friday night with another explosive night of bouts for fight fans. In the main event, Amir "King" Khan (31-3, 19 KOs) scored a crafty and hard fought unanimous decision over Chris Algieri (20-2, 8 KOs) and Javier Fortuna (28-0-1, 20 KOs) won a crowd-pleasing unanimous decision victory over Bryan Vasquez (34-2, 18 KOs) in the televised opener.
